12 Sustainable Home Upgrades For Greater Savings

With a growing concern for the future of our planet, we all need to do our part to improve its present state. Are you looking for ways to lower your carbon footprint? Luckily, you don’t have to go out of your way to make a change. Living sustainably and making sustainable upgrades to your home is a great place to start. And here are some easy ways you can do that.

1. Become a Mindful Energy User

Start by becoming mindful of your consumption. From the food you buy to the amount of energy you use, everything has an impact on your carbon footprint. 

Switch off lights to minimize your energy consumption. For food, buy locally farmed, organic produce.

2. Utilize Natural Light

Another great way to lower your dependence on fossil-fuel generated electricity is by utilizing natural light. During winter, open up your curtain to naturally warm up your house. If you’re planning to build a house, make sure the blueprint includes sufficient windows.

3. Install Energy-Efficient Lighting

CFLs and halogen lights consume more electricity than required. Replace them with LED lighting fixtures that consume less energy and last much longer. They might be the pricier option, but the benefits justify the cost. 

4. Switch to Renewable Energy Plans

You can further improve your energy consumption by switching to a renewable energy plan. Solar, wind, hydro, and other renewable energy sources don’t contribute to greenhouse gas emissions as much as non-renewable energy. 5. Adjust Thermostat

Keeping your house overly cold or hot will drive up your energy bills. Whenever you leave your house or go to sleep, adjust your thermostat accordingly. Also, by wearing more clothes during colder weather, you can reduce the need for high heating.

6. Install Solar Panels

In case of unavailability of renewable energy plans, you can generate your own power by installing solar panels. Even partially meeting your needs will make a difference. Also, you’ll get to enjoy greater energy savings.

7. Upgrade Appliances

Old appliances are not only inefficient but also use up more energy. If you’re shopping for new household appliances, always check for Energy Star ratings. Appliances with high ratings are more energy efficient. In addition to sustainable consumption, they will also lower your energy bills.

8. Avoid Water Wastage

Aerated faucets, low-flow showerheads, and flushes are some economic upgrades that will help you avoid water wastage. You should also get any plumbing leaks immediately fixed.

9. Get Your HVAC System Repaired & Serviced

To ensure that your HVAC system is working optimally, you may need to get it serviced at least twice a year. HVAC contributes a major portion to your overall energy consumption. Regular servicing is a way to maintain its efficiency.

10. Use Refurbished Wood

If you’re planning to install a hardwood floor or build a shed, go for refurbished wood instead of brand-new hardwood. It’s affordable, better for the environment, and offers a rustic touch.

11. Improve Insulation

In addition to lowering energy consumption, it’s also necessary to retain energy. Make sure your house is adequately insulated to retain energy. Window treatment is another way to prevent energy loss.

12. Use Sustainable Building Materials

Are you building a new house from the ground up or planning a home extension? There are several sustainable building materials available that are recycled and have a lower impact on the environment. Ask your contractor to incorporate environmentally-friendly materials.
